Family Fun Nights at the school are a great way to get parents more involved in their children's school. Parents and children have the opportunity to meet and socialize with other families while participating in a fun activity. Family Fun Nights not only help build a school spirit, they can also be an opportunity to raise some money for your school.

Many schools have one night the whole family each month throughout the school year. Other organizations such as churches and clubs as well as major non-profit such as zoos, museums and aquariums can also hold nights for the whole family for their members.

Some of the activities of your organization nonprofit can try nights for the whole family.

Sales of Ice Cream Social, Bake-offs and Cook

Movie Night with popcorn and other Gourmet

Book fairs, carnivals, holiday Shops, Pet Parades

Star Gazing

Math-a-thons, read-a-thons, Science Nights sports tournaments

Game nights such as trivia games, bingo, cards or puzzles

Dances or dances and dance classes

Talent shows, Karaoke shows

nights crafts, pottery painting

Outdoor activities such as kite flying, sandcastle building, plant flowers

Presentations by experts from the community on topics of interest to families such as

Education Savings, identity theft, cooking, health and safety, etc.

Family Fun Nights are also held other places that can accommodate large groups of people such as bowling alleys, arenas, cinemas, parks and restaurants. On these sites, that such undertakings may to donate a portion of proceeds back to school.

Remember, the focus should be on fun. But there are ways to earn money for the organization, at the same time. Some of the ways to earn money during the nights of the family are:

Hold a raffle for a gift basket or gift certificate. View point during the evening and give the prize to the end.

Sell school spirit items such as t-shirts and bumper stickers.

Collecting recyclables that can earn money for your organization such as ink cartridges computer and cell phones.

Collect Box Tops and labels to box and label it.

Sale Scrip products or market day.

If your organization is trying to sell products such as candy, cookies or pasta, a display set up for parents can buy them.

Make sure you have AA or information on your table to organize fun nights. Provide information to parents about upcoming events and opportunities for fundraising. Ask parents to sign up volunteers to help in the future.

Family Fun nights, so they can not make a large amount of fundraising dollars, will help build relationships between parents and increase their participation in your school or organization. When parents are more involved, they are more likely to want to volunteer to help you with your fund raising efforts.
